Niagara Purple Eagles schedule, November 2019
The Niagara Purple Eagles had 5 NCAA games scheduled on the month of November 2019.
They went 0-5 overall. 0-4 on the road, and 0-1 at home. Their biggest loss came on the road against the Rutgers Scarlet Knights (86-39), led by Geo Baker (22 points, 3 rebounds, 4 assists).
The Niagara Purple Eagles scored 59.80 points per game on November 2019, and allowed 79.40 points per game to their opponents.
During the month of November 2019, James Towns led the team in scoring with 13.80 points per game. Marcus Hammond averaged 2.20 assists and Greg Kuakumensah had 3.80 rebounds per contest.
Niagara Purple Eagles schedule, December 2019
The Niagara Purple Eagles had 6 NCAA games scheduled on the month of December 2019.
They went 2-4 overall. 1-4 on the road, and 1-0 at home. Their largest win came home against the Colgate Raiders (93-82) on December 08, 2019. That night James Towns scored 26 points. Their biggest loss came on the road against the Buffalo Bulls (92-72), led by Jayvon Graves (22 points, 5 rebounds, 6 assists).
Their longest winning streak on December 2019: 2 consecutive wins against Norfolk State Spartans and Colgate Raiders.
The Niagara Purple Eagles scored 72.83 points per game on December 2019, and allowed 79.50 points per game to their opponents.
During the month of December 2019, James Towns led the team in scoring with 15.50 points per game. Marcus Hammond averaged 4.17 assists and Greg Kuakumensah had 4.50 rebounds per contest.
Niagara Purple Eagles schedule, January 2020
The Niagara Purple Eagles had 9 NCAA games scheduled on the month of January 2020.
They went 4-5 overall. 1-3 on the road, and 3-2 at home. Their largest win came home against the Fairfield Stags (75-66) on January 03, 2020. That night James Towns scored 18 points. Their biggest loss came home against the Marist Red Foxes (67-48), led by Jordan Jones (18 points, 8 rebounds, 2 assists).
Their longest winning streak on January 2020: 3 consecutive wins against Iona Gaels, Rider Broncs and Siena Saints.
The Niagara Purple Eagles scored 64.11 points per game on January 2020, and allowed 68.33 points per game to their opponents.
During the month of January 2020, Marcus Hammond led the team in scoring with 16.11 points per game. Marcus Hammond averaged 2.67 assists and Marcus Hammond had 4.56 rebounds per contest.
Niagara Purple Eagles schedule, February 2020
The Niagara Purple Eagles had 9 NCAA games scheduled on the month of February 2020.
They went 5-4 overall. 0-4 on the road, and 5-0 at home. Their largest win came home against the Quinnipiac Bobcats (75-59) on February 02, 2020. That night Marcus Hammond scored 23 points. Their biggest loss came on the road against the Marist Red Foxes (76-54), led by Jordan Jones (18 points, 6 rebounds, 3 assists).
Their longest winning streak on February 2020: 2 consecutive wins against Canisius Golden Griffins and Monmouth Hawks.
The Niagara Purple Eagles scored 68.33 points per game on February 2020, and allowed 69.89 points per game to their opponents.
During the month of February 2020, Marcus Hammond led the team in scoring with 17.89 points per game. Marcus Hammond averaged 2.44 assists and Marcus Hammond had 6.22 rebounds per contest.
Niagara Purple Eagles schedule, March 2020
The Niagara Purple Eagles had 3 NCAA games scheduled on the month of March 2020.
They went 1-2 overall. 0-2 on the road, and 1-0 at home. Their largest win came home against the Marist Red Foxes (56-54) on March 10, 2020. That night Marcus Hammond scored 20 points. Their biggest loss came on the road against the Siena Saints (77-55), led by Elijah Burns (24 points, 10 rebounds, 1 assists).
Their longest winning streak on March 2020: 1 consecutive wins against Marist Red Foxes.
The Niagara Purple Eagles scored 58.00 points per game on March 2020, and allowed 66.00 points per game to their opponents.
During the month of March 2020, Marcus Hammond led the team in scoring with 12.33 points per game. Shandon Brown averaged 4.00 assists and Marcus Hammond had 4.67 rebounds per contest.
